A lotta people talk the old red knob princeton chorus solid state amp down....but I gotta tell ya, it is a great amp for clean tones and has the older bo** chorus pedal circuit for some really nice mellow chorus effects built in. It also handles other pedals quite well and is a no brainer for toting around to practices as it has no tubes to worry with, so the next time you are in need of a good clean sounding amp, a no issue or minimal problem amp or even a backup or reliable practice amp, give these a look, usually cheap and you will be glad you did.

I have a Red Knob Princeton Chorus SS and I really like this amp. I bought it new back in 1990 and it is still going strong. I am even thinking of using this amp at band rehersal. For now I use it as my home practice amp and I agree 100% with your evaluation of the amp. Great clean tones and takes pedals very well. The built in chorus is pretty good. The reverb isn't that great though and best if left with just a touch used.
